The Organisation
Australian Eggs is a member owned not-for-profit company providing marketing, research and development services for the benefit of Australian egg farmers. Working together with the egg industry and the Australian Government, Australian Eggs strives to deliver value to industry and the public by investing in programs that increase consumption and ensure industry sustainability.
Australian Eggs programs focus on delivering research and innovation for improving farming practices, and marketing activities that promote eggs as a nutritious, safe and versatile source of protein for all life stages.
